Butler is a small, charming town located in DeKalb County, Indiana. With a population of just over 3,000 residents, Butler is a close-knit community with a rich history and a strong sense of community pride.

The town of Butler was founded in 1856, and its early growth was fueled by the construction of the Wabash and Erie Canal. The town was named after William Orlando Butler, a general in the Mexican-American War.

Butler is known for its beautiful parks and outdoor recreational opportunities. The town is home to several parks, including Butler Park and Riverside Garden Park, where residents can enjoy picnicking, walking trails, and playgrounds. The nearby Cedar Creek provides opportunities for fishing, canoeing, and wildlife viewing.

One of the town’s most iconic landmarks is the historic Butler Historic District. This area features a collection of beautifully preserved buildings and homes dating back to the 19th century. Visitors can take a leisurely stroll through the district and admire the town’s rich architectural heritage.

In addition to its natural beauty and historical charm, Butler also offers a variety of shops, restaurants, and local businesses. The town’s Main Street is lined with quaint storefronts and offers a range of dining options, from classic American fare to international cuisine.

Butler also hosts a number of community events and festivals throughout the year. The town’s Fourth of July celebration is a beloved tradition, featuring a parade, live music, and fireworks. The annual Butler Fall Festival is another popular event, with activities for all ages, including a car show, craft vendors, and a chili cook-off.
